Our workshop yesterday went awesomely. I don’t think that’s actually a word but it went really well. We had about 75 people attend and only about 60 seats, so it was standing room only. We talked about making your media matter and the big idea for us is that all the media you use should serve the message and shouldn’t be used simply because it’s cool. When used properly, media can work hand in hand with all of your programming to build a theme for your service that perfectly sets up the pastor’s message. We ran a mock Creative Team meeting. We gave away a free Programming Pack to everyone who attended. It was great.

Seriously, though. We are honored to have been asked/invited by Worship House Media to present a couple of sessions at the conference. We’re calling our session “Stop Substance Abuse: Make Your Media Matter.” The basic message will be style over substance. We’ll be talking and having a dialogue about using all the media in your service to support the overall theme. How all of your media can work together to set up and support the message that the pastor has for everyone. We’ve got a basic outline, but we’re still working on the details.
